How it works

Enter your own mobile number.

Use a valid personal phone number you can access. Double-check the country code and number format before submitting to avoid delivery issues.

Request the verification code on CityMall.

Choose sign up, login, password reset, or another account action, then tap Send code. Avoid repeated taps, since too many requests can delay delivery or trigger temporary blocks.

Wait briefly for the SMS to arrive.

Most codes arrive quickly, but some may take a little longer because of network congestion, carrier filtering, or device settings. Wait a short time before trying again.

Enter the OTP before it expires.

When the message arrives, copy the code exactly as shown and submit it promptly. Verification codes often expire after a short period for security reasons.

Troubleshoot carefully if the code does not arrive.

Confirm your phone number is correct, check your mobile signal, make sure SMS messages are not blocked, and then request a new code only if needed.

Switzerland number format (quick copy)

  • Country code: +41

  • International prefix (dialing out locally): 00

  • Trunk prefix (local): 0 (drop it when using +41)

  • Mobile pattern (common for OTP):07X locally → +41 7X… internationally

  • Typical length in forms: Switzerland is a closed plan; full national numbers are typically 10 digits domestically (incl. leading 0), and 9 digits after +41 (without the 0).

  • Common mobile prefixes: 75 / 76 / 77 / 78 / 79

Common pattern (example):

  • Mobile (local): 076 123 45 67 → International: +41 76 123 45 67

Quick tip: If the form rejects spaces/dashes, paste it as +41761234567 (digits only).
